吉隆坡服务器如何支撑电商高并发:关键架构与优化实战

在东南亚乃至全球市场扩张的电商平台,面对促销峰值与地域性流量突发,服务器的架构与在地部署起着决定性作用。吉隆坡服务器因其地理位置靠近东南亚主流市场、成本与网络延迟优势,成为许多企业在区域节点选址中的优选。本篇从原理、典型应用场景、架构实践与选购建议四个维度,详述如何用吉隆坡服务器支撑电商的高并发场景,并在文中自然比较香港服务器、美国服务器等不同部署策略的利弊,面向站长、企业用户与开发者提供可落地的优化实战建议。

一、支撑高并发的核心原理

电商高并发主要来自并发请求数、并发数据库连接和后端异步任务三部分。要稳健支撑高并发,需在以下层面做整体设计:

1. 前端与边缘优化(减少到源站的并发)

  • CDN 缓存与动态内容分层:将商品页静态资源(图片、JS、CSS)放到 CDN 边缘节点,动态内容采取边缘缓存或边缘渲染策略,显著减少吉隆坡源站的请求压力。尤其在东南亚内部署时,可结合新加坡、香港节点以降低延迟。
  • 缓存策略与缓存失效控制:使用 Cache-Control、ETag 以及基于版本号的静态资源路径来避免缓存穿透。在促销活动中对热点商品采用短 TTL 与主动预热。
  • 前端降级与流量控制:在高并发期间对非核心功能做降级(如推荐模块异步化),并通过 token bucket、漏桶等限流算法保护后端。

2. 负载分发与弹性伸缩

  • 智能负载均衡:在吉隆坡机房使用 L4(TCP)与 L7(HTTP)负载均衡组合。L7 用于会话粘性、路径路由,L4 用于大并发、低延迟转发。可采用 Nginx、HAProxy 或云厂商的 LB 服务。
  • 水平扩容与自动伸缩:以无状态服务为主,使用容器化(Docker + Kubernetes)或自动化脚本实现基于 CPU/RTT/队列长度的自动扩容;数据库与缓存层采用读写分离与横向扩容策略。

3. 数据层与一致性处理

  • 主从复制与读写分离:MySQL 主从复制配合负载均衡读写分离,写压力集中到主库,读压力分摊到只读节点,同时注意主从延迟问题。
  • 分库分表与垂直拆分:对订单、用户、商品等实体进行合理拆分,避免单表热点。分片策略可以基于用户 ID、时间窗口或地域。
  • 内存缓存与持久化结合:使用 Redis 做热点数据缓存、分布式锁与计数器,采用持久化(AOF/RDB)与哨兵/Cluster 模式提高可用性。
  • 消息队列解耦峰值写入:采用 Kafka/RabbitMQ 将订单写入、通知、日志等异步化,削峰填谷并保证最终一致性。

4. 连接管理与资源池化

  • 数据库连接池:合理配置连接池(如 HikariCP)最大连接数、超时和回收策略,避免连接暴涨导致 DB OOM 或 CPU 陷入上下文切换。
  • HTTP keep-alive 与反向代理连接复用:提升请求复用率,降低 TCP 握手开销。

二、吉隆坡机房在电商场景的应用实践

基于吉隆坡服务器的特性,下面给出几种典型实践模板,便于工程化落地。

模板A:低延迟区域站点(面对马来西亚、印尼、新加坡用户)

  • 边缘:全球 CDN + 新加坡/吉隆坡 POP。
  • 应用层:吉隆坡搭建多可用区负载均衡 + Kubernetes 集群,容器化部署应用。
  • 缓存层:Redis Cluster 部署于吉隆坡,热数据就近访问;画像/推荐等可在香港或日本的节点做异地备份。
  • 数据库:MySQL 主节点在吉隆坡,多只读副本分布在新加坡与香港提高区域读取能力。

模板B:全球促销活动(跨区域突发流量)

  • 全球入口使用 Anycast + CDN,将静态与部分动态在边缘处理;核心交易在吉隆坡与香港双活。
  • 采用消息队列(Kafka)在各区域入队,本地快速响应用户,后端按序消费完成最终一致性。
  • 采用灰度发布与流量裂变控制,促销时刻对非关键路径进行降级。

模板C:成本敏感但需要稳定性的中小电商

  • 首选吉隆坡或新加坡的 VPS/云服务器做应用与 DB(按需选择香港VPS或美国VPS作为远程备份)。
  • 使用托管的 CDN 和简化的读写分离,配合按需伸缩策略以降低闲置成本。

三、关键优化实战细节

以下为工程师在实战中常用、且能带来明显效果的优化项:

HTTP 层与 Nginx 调优

  • 配置 worker_processes 与 worker_connections,调优 epoll 参数以支持数万并发连接。
  • 启用 sendfile、tcp_nopush、tcp_nodelay 减少系统调用与包延迟。
  • 配置 upstream keepalive 连接池复用后端连接,减少后端 TCP 建立成本。

应用层限流与队列

  • 采用漏桶/令牌桶限流在入口网关层降速;对下游服务设置熔断策略(如 Hystrix / Resilience4j)。
  • 将下单、发券等高峰操作异步化,使用队列消峰并确保幂等性设计。

数据库调优与架构保障

  • 索引优化、慢查询分析(使用 pt-query-digest),避免全表扫描;对大事务进行拆分。
  • 采用分区表(按时间/地域)减小单表扫描范围;结合连接池与读写分离减少争用。
  • 设置合理的 binlog_format、innodb_buffer_pool_size(一般 >= 可用内存的 60%-80%)提高吞吐。

监控、预警与故障演练

  • 部署完整的观测体系:指标(Prometheus)、日志(ELK/EFK)、分布式追踪(Jaeger/Zipkin)。
  • 建立 SLO/SLI,制定故障恢复(RTO/RPO)与演练流程,定期进行压测(JMeter、k6)验证弹性边界。

四、优势对比:吉隆坡与其他地区机房

在选择服务器节点时,除了技术实现,还需考虑延迟、成本、合规与网络互联性。

吉隆坡 vs 新加坡/香港

  • 延迟:吉隆坡对马来西亚与印尼部分区域延迟更低;新加坡与香港在金融与国际互联性上更优。
  • 成本与带宽:吉隆坡通常在带宽成本与机房费用上更具优势。
  • 合规与数据主权:对马来西亚本地用户选择吉隆坡可更容易满足本地合规要求。

吉隆坡 vs 日本/韩国/美国

  • 对东亚用户日本/韩国延迟更优;美国服务器适合北美市场但跨太平洋延迟高。
  • 全球促销通常采用多区域混合部署:吉隆坡负责东南亚,美国/欧洲节点负责美欧流量,香港/新加坡作为中转与容灾。

五、选购建议(站长与企业角度)

在决定使用吉隆坡服务器、香港服务器、美国服务器或选择香港VPS、美国VPS 时,建议按以下维度评估:

评估维度

  • 目标用户地域:主要在东南亚则优先吉隆坡或新加坡;若全球化则采用多区域混合。
  • 预算与扩展性:中小企业可先用 VPS(例如香港VPS/美国VPS)快速上线,随后迁移到云或独立服务器以提高稳定性。
  • 网络与带宽:选择具有优质国际出口与与主要 CDN/IX 互联良好的机房,降低跨境访问延迟。
  • 合规与域名解析:注意域名注册与 DNS 策略(可将域名注册和 DNS 服务分离),确保解析全球冗余;在特定市场关注数据主权要求。
  • 备份与容灾方案:多机房、多可用区与多地域备份,关键业务建议做异地热备或双活。

总结

通过合理地把控前端 CDN、负载均衡、应用无状态化、数据库分库分表与缓存体系,以及完善的监控与压测流程,吉隆坡服务器可以为电商业务提供既低延迟又可扩展的高并发支撑。针对不同业务规模,可在吉隆坡、新加坡、香港、日本、韩国与美国等节点之间做组合部署,实现成本与性能的平衡。对于希望在马来西亚与东南亚市场深耕的站长与企业,选择可靠的马来西亚服务器并配合上述架构与优化实战,将能显著提升促销活动期间的稳定性与用户体验。

更多关于马来西亚服务器的产品信息与部署方案,可参见后浪云的马来西亚服务器页面:https://www.idc.net/my。若需了解其他海外节点(如香港服务器、美国服务器、日本服务器、韩国服务器、新加坡服务器)或域名注册与香港VPS/美国VPS 的配套建议,也可访问后浪云首页获取更多技术与产品支持:https://www.idc.net/

THE END